Transaction 65efc09bcbf59019c71540fa427260f49c72d2c444aeb486b26a6dd07caf04e5

1 Input
2 Outputs
  • 65efc09bcbf59019c71540fa427260f49c72d2c444aeb486b26a6dd07caf04e5:0
  • value  3768510
    address  12quqMXNBfdB9swVMNgWUe3G9KR7TDK3j5
  • 65efc09bcbf59019c71540fa427260f49c72d2c444aeb486b26a6dd07caf04e5:1
  • value  1046275
    address  37DPEDWokBhDBdcPtNQFKCYQPppqPqX1tN